An increasing number of young people would like to start their business in Macao although its size is only 1/500 of Beijing. "We cannot limit our market to 670,000 people in Macao but ignore the 1.4 billion people in the Chinese mainland," said Ho Iat-seng, Chief Executive-elect of Macao.
